So picked the car up recently with the new Mfactory 4.64 final drive fitted. It’s definitely made a huge difference to how the car drives. Much more aggressive throughout the rev range and always wanting to ‘go’.

One of the gripes you hear sometimes about the H series engine is that it revs a tad lazy in comparison to the B series stuff of the same era. The best way I can describe the difference the final drive has made it is that it’s still got the torque and horsepower benefits of the H series engine, but now also rev’s like a B series.(y)

Tbh I haven’t launched it or even hit it hard in 1st since getting it back. It wasn’t up to much before so will be worse now. 2nd gear rolls are fine providing its absolutely bone dry. Any dampness and it’ll break loose straight away.

70mph in 5th is 3900rpm or so, approx 400rpm higher than before.

Tbh even though it’s a shorter final drive, it’s not silly short (they make a 5.1 for this box but I’ve a feeling that would be terrible on the road) The standard item was a pretty long 4.266, so the 4.64 is only really bringing it in line with the likes of a dc2 box. It’s a nice compromise between making the car more aggressive, yet still maintaining reasonable speeds in each gear and top end etc.
